OneCareer Unveils New Logo to Mark 10th Anniversary Milestone

OneCareer Celebrates 10 Years with a New Logo



In 2025, OneCareer will proudly celebrate its 10th anniversary, marking a significant milestone in the company’s journey. To commemorate this occasion, the Tokyo-based career data platform company has reimagined its logo, refreshing its brand identity in alignment with its mission: "Creating careers as unique as the individuals themselves."

The logo redesign is accompanied by a rebranding of its services. The newly consolidated service names are as follows:
  • - ONE CAREER and ONE CAREER CLOUD will now be unified under the brand name ワンキャリア (OneCareer).
  • - The career transition support service, formerly known as ONE CAREER PLUS, has been renamed ワンキャリア転職 (OneCareer Recruiting).

Background of the Change



Since its inception, OneCareer has aimed to provide a platform where job seekers and companies can leverage comprehensive data to make informed career choices. Over the years, it has achieved impressive milestones, including surpassing 2 million registered members and partnering with over 5,000 companies. By demystifying career data often considered a black box, the platform has been instrumental in reducing mismatches in career choices.

In recent years, OneCareer has intensified its offerings by enhancing various categories such as regions, industries, and job types while incorporating new technologies like AI and generative AI into its service enhancements. This strategic focus has broadened its user base, fostering inclusivity.

As the company reaches its 10th anniversary, the decision to adopt the katakana name ワンキャリア reflects a desire for a more approachable and relatable brand image, making the platform even more accessible to a wider audience.

About OneCareer



Founded on August 18, 2015, OneCareer is committed to its mission of creating unique career paths for individuals. It offers three main services:
  • - A first-time career selection platform for students: ワンキャリア (Student Version)
  • - A job transition platform for professionals: ワンキャリア転職 (Recruitment)
  • - A new graduate recruitment service promoting digital transformation for companies: ワンキャリア (Corporate Version)

Company Information:
  • - Name: OneCareer, Inc.
  • - Headquarters: 20-1 Sakuragaokacho, Shibuya, Tokyo
  • - Business Areas: Career data platform services (recruitment support and more)
  • - Stock Code: 4377 (Tokyo Growth Market)
  • - Website: onecareer.co.jp
